Dear Tuesday
I hate you
You suck
Go die in a hole

You know the one
The one by the side of the road
The one that fills up with water every time it rains
The one that makes a big splash when the cars drive by

You know the one
The hole the man promised to fill
But they don't care do they?
They don't care about the little side streets
They say thats not true
But if they cared they would do something
They would stop teh cars from speeding down my hill
The hill with the holes at the bottom
They'd have done something before the car hit my neighbors cat

You know the one
The gray one
We were six
And truthfully we're lucky it wasn't us
It could have been
One day it will be

You know the one
The day in the future
The day where the man will see his broken promises
The day where the man will look at the hole in the street
The day the man will install a speed bump
Or a traffic circle

Tuesday this is your fate
To lay in the hole
The one that reminds us of all that is wrong with the world
To lay in that hole
And pretend you don't exist
Let the world drive over you
Splash you
Then you will see
What it's like to be us

Then you will see
The pain you bring
With each morning that you bring
You're evil
You deserve that little hole

Do not think me mean
For I am simply speaking that which is the truth
One day you will understand
The pain with which you bring

Dear Tuesday
I hate you
You suck
Go die in a hole
